Abstract:
We investigate the feasibility of studying in-medium properties of the omega meson in photoproduction experiments via the decay omega -> pi(0)gamma. We use the GiBUU transport model to compare different methods of obtaining in-medium information, such as the invariant mass spectrum, transparency ratio, excitation function and momentum spectrum. We show that the final-state interaction of the pion poses a major obstacle for the interpretation of the invariant mass spectrum. The other three observables turn out to be fairly independent of final-state interactions and thus, taken together, can give access to the omega's in-medium properties. (c) 2013 Elsevier B.V.
